Affiliate Marketing – An Introduction Affiliate marketing is a type of marketing strategy in which the affiliate receives payment for referring customers or generating sales of a company’s goods or services. The merchant (also known as the advertiser), the affiliate (also known as the publisher), and the client are the three main participants in this strategy. Brands can make money in several ways, such as pay-per-click, cost-per-impression, sales commissions, and CPA. They can also advertise and market their retail goods and services through blogs, social media marketing, emails, websites, and other electronic channels. Because affiliate marketing targets a large number of consumers and there are no start-up costs, it is advantageous for businesses because they only pay if they see results. Without creating their items, affiliates have a decent opportunity to earn money and attract customers with their audience and content. Because it leverages the affiliate’s marketing experience and the merchants’ items, this agreement guarantees the growth of both sides. Affiliate marketing has become a preferred strategy for achieving corporate objectives since it is a cost-effective and efficient means of market dissemination.
